Remove any recoil reference from project (#18250)
## Remove all Recoil references and replace with Jotai ### Summary - Removed every occurrence of Recoil from the entire codebase, replacing with Jotai equivalents where applicable - Updated `README.md` tech stack: `Recoil` → `Jotai` - Rewrote documentation code examples to use `createAtomState`/`useAtomState` instead of `atom`/`useRecoilState`, and removed `RecoilRoot` wrappers - Cleaned up source code comment and Cursor rules that referenced Recoil - Applied changes across all 13 locale translations (ar, cs, de, es, fr, it, ja, ko, pt, ro, ru, tr, zh)
